First off, what's creep? Creep is the slow, continuous deformation of a material under a constant load over time. It might not seem like a big deal at first, but in the long run, it can really mess things up. For a Linking Rod, which is used in all sorts of machinery and equipment, creep can lead to misalignment, reduced performance, and even complete failure.

Imagine a Linking Rod in a piece of fitness equipment. Linking Rod are used to connect different parts of the machine, allowing for smooth and efficient movement. If the Linking Rod starts to creep, the connections can become loose, and the equipment might not work as it should. This can be a major headache for both the users and the manufacturers.

So, how do we measure the creep resistance of a Linking Rod? Well, there are a few key factors to consider. One of the most important is the material the Linking Rod is made of. Different materials have different levels of creep resistance. For example, some high - strength alloys are known for their excellent creep resistance. They can withstand high loads for long periods without significant deformation.

Another factor is the temperature. Creep is more likely to occur at higher temperatures. When a Linking Rod is exposed to heat, the atoms in the material start to move more freely, making it easier for the material to deform. So, if a Linking Rod is used in an environment with high temperatures, we need to make sure it has good creep resistance.

The design of the Linking Rod also plays a role. A well - designed Linking Rod will distribute the load evenly, reducing the stress on any one part of the rod. This can help to minimize creep. For instance, a Linking Rod with a proper cross - sectional shape can handle the load better than one with a poorly designed shape.

When it comes to testing the creep resistance of our Linking Rods, we use a variety of methods. We conduct laboratory tests where we subject the Linking Rods to constant loads at different temperatures for extended periods. We measure the deformation of the rods over time to determine their creep resistance. We also perform real - world tests in actual applications to see how the Linking Rods perform under normal operating conditions.
